Last Day To Buy American Miles

Some of you are VERY well stocked with American Airlines miles. I know you took advantage of the big credit card offers, especially when you were able to pick up 100,000 miles a pop. Right? Right??

Well, if not, you can buy a few today. That isn’t my favorite strategy, but it’s a decent price for the right buyer. The sweet spot is 70,000 miles with 35,000 more as a free bonus. It’ll cost you around 2 cents a mile…4 times as much as the annual fee would have been on that 100,000-mile Executive card. Still a good deal for some. Not me, but some. Have a great weekend!

New FlexPerks Card

If you spend thousands at grocery stores on…well, you know…the FlexPerks card is incredible. For every 20,000 points, you get another free flight up to $400. Such an underrated card for people who use it well. And now there’s a new 20,000-point bonus from Amex here. That’s in addition to the ol’ US Bank Personal and Business versions (20,000 each). If that isn’t enough, there are also the 10,000-point cards.  No shortage of ways to rack up these points…
